HR 1831 · 94th Congress · Cemeteries and funerals

A bill to insure that a national cemetery is established in each State, and for other purposes.

Introduced 1975-01-23· Sponsored by Rep. Eilberg, Joshua [D-PA-4]· House

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Authorizes the Secretaty of the Army to: (1) establish a national cemetery in each State in which there is no national cemetery; and (2) provide for the maintenance and care of each such cemetery. Authorizes appropriation of such sums as are necessary to carry out the purposes of this Act. Provides, with respect to veterans' funeral expenses, for an additional burial allowance of $400 for veterans interred in other than a national cemetery. (Adds 38 U.S.C. 902(c)).…
